Sentences with SECESH (5)

Garrett, and like him very well, and if I believed--which I don’t, by any means--all the things some people say about his ‘secesh’ principles, he might say to you as was said by the Superintendent of a certain railroad to a son of one my predecessors in office.
Lincoln’s Yarns and Stories Alexander K. McClure 2001
Louis is unhealthy for our children, and because most of the Catholics here are tainted with the old secesh feeling.
The Memoirs of General W. T. Sherman, Vol. II. William T. Sherman 2006
Moreover, the North was vastly stronger than the South on all the inland waters that were not "Secesh" from end to end.
Captains of the Civil War William Wood 2006
Having been warned not to be too rampant on the subject of slavery, as secesh principles flourished even under the respectable nose of Father Abraham, I had endeavored to walk discreetly, and curb my unruly member; looking about me with all my eyes, the while, and saving up the result of my observations for future use.
Hospital Sketches Louisa May Alcott 2003
The oranges cost a cent apiece, and the cattle were Secesh, bestowed by General Saxby, as they all call him.
Army Life in a Black Regiment Thomas Wentworth Higginson 2004
